Jovibarba globifera, commonly known as the globe-bearing jovibarba, belongs to the Crassulaceae family. This succulent is native to the mountain ranges of Central and Eastern Europe, where it thrives in rocky environments and crevices.

The crop is highly adapted to nutrient-poor, stony, or sandy soils, provided they have exceptional drainage. It requires full sun exposure to maintain its characteristic compact rosette structure and vibrant foliage color.

As a drought-tolerant species, it requires minimal irrigation once established. However, the cultivation must prioritize water management, as excessive moisture around the roots can lead to immediate physiological stress and decay.

This succulent displays impressive winter hardiness, making it suitable for year-round outdoor cultivation in temperate zones. It thrives in well-ventilated locations with low air humidity during the dormant season.

In terms of agricultural and horticultural use, Jovibarba globifera is primarily valued for rock gardens, green roofs, and dry stone walls. Its ability to colonize difficult terrains makes it an excellent choice for ornamental ground cover.

Main diseases and pests

The primary threat to the health of the crop is root rot caused by poor soil drainage or excessive water accumulation within the succulent rosettes during the wet season.

Mealybugs are the most common pests that can infest the plant, feeding on cell sap and causing stunted growth if left unmanaged throughout the growing season.

Slugs and snails may occasionally feed on the leaves, especially in damp conditions, which can significantly damage the appearance and vitality of the colony.

Disease prevention involves ensuring a free-draining substrate and spacing plants sufficiently to promote air circulation and quick drying of the foliage after rainfall.

Chemical control should be used sparingly, prioritizing preventative measures such as site selection and soil preparation to keep the plants robust and resistant to potential infections.
